Job Description
The role
We’re looking for a highly driven, tech-savvy Enterprise Business Development Representative who blends traditional outbound excellence with modern AI-powered workflows. In this hybrid role, you’ll generate high-quality pipeline for our Enterprise Sales team by combining account intelligence, multi-channel outreach, and advanced AI tools to work smarter and deliver personalised, high-impact engagement.
You’ll partner closely with Sales, Marketing, and Account Management to execute account-based strategies across the UK&I region, using both proven BDR tactics and cutting-edge automation to identify opportunities, get in front of decision-makers, and convert interest into sales accepted leads.
Your Day-to-Day
Core Enterprise BDR Responsibilities
- Qualify and develop inbound and outbound leads, ensuring timely follow-up on product inquiries.
- Gather actionable account intelligence (competition, projects, intent signals, buying teams, etc.).
- Convert marketing-generated leads into sales accepted opportunities.
- Run targeted email, phone, LinkedIn, and event follow-up outreach sequences.
- Execute cold-calling and telephone-based prospecting campaigns.
- Coordinate and schedule discovery calls and demos for the Enterprise Sales team.
- Maintain detailed and accurate activity notes in Salesforce (or equivalent CRM).
AI & Systems-Driven Responsibilities
- Use AI tools (ChatGPT, Clay, Actively, Apollo, Outreach, Lavender, etc.) to research accounts, identify decision-makers, and generate personalised messaging at scale.
- Apply AI to translate, summarise, and tailor outreach for different regions or verticals.
- Automate repetitive tasks and build efficient workflows using tools such as Zapier or native CRM automations.
- Conduct data-driven experiments to optimise sequences, messaging, subject lines, and engagement triggers.
- Analyse performance metrics to improve conversion rates across channels.
- Stay current on emerging AI platforms and integrate new capabilities into daily processes.
